W1 – MTR PWR
The MTR PWR quick connect provides voltage to the line
side of the fan speed relays through an external jumper. For
PSC motors, this will be the line voltage of the unit. For EC
motors, this will either be 24VAC (without PWM) or a switch
contact common (with PWM).

W2 – EARTH
EARTH connection grounds the secondary side of the
transformer to the enclosure cabinet through a wire bonded
to the control enclosure.
